Requirements

  • * Strong technical skills (Q/kdb, Python, SQL, Git) for statistical and econometric analysis
  • * Advanced degree in a quantitative field such as Statistics, Engineering, Computer Science, Physics, or Mathematics.
  • * 2-5 years' experience in Structured Products

Responsibilities

  • Research, develop, and deploy of MS prepayment/fundamental models.
  • Strong collaboration with trading desk on trading ideas generation.
  • Ownership and maintenance of desk and client facing projects
